The hexadecimal color code #6BBDC6 corresponds to the code RGB( 107, 189, 198 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,42 level), green (at 0,74 level) and blue (at 0,78 level). Its brightness is 59% and its saturation is 44%. It is composed of red at 21%, green at 38% and blue at 40%.

The complementary color #944239 is the color exactly opposite to #6BBDC6 on the color wheel. The triadic palette is created by selecting two colors that are evenly spaced on the color wheel.
